### 内容主体大纲 1. **引言** - TPWallet的功能简介 - 为什么打包过程中可能出现问题 2. **TPWallet打包的基本步骤** - 环境准备 - 代码编写 - 打包命令和工具的选择 3. **常见的打包问题** - 编译错误 - 依赖库缺失 - 运行时错误 4. **逐步解决打包问题的策略** - 清理和重新编译 - 检查依赖关系 - 更新工具和库 5. **如何TPWallet的打包过程** - 使用Docker容器 - 增加打包速度的技巧 - 代码和资源的结构 6. **目标平台的适配** - 安卓平台适配的注意事项 - iOS平台适配的注意事项 7. **常见问题解答(FAQ)** - 如何排查未知问题? - 打包错误如何定位? - 有哪些工具可以辅助打包? - 怎样处理第三方库的兼容性问题? - 如果使用了旧版TPWallet,可能遇到什么问题? - 如何提升打包的稳定性? - 社区和论坛的资源利用 ### 内容概述 #### 引言

TPWallet是一款广泛应用于区块链领域的数字钱包,旨在为用户提供安全、便捷的加密资产管理服务。而在开发和部署TPWallet应用时,打包是一个非常重要的步骤。对于许多开发者来说,打包过程中可能会遇到各类问题,如何有效地解决这些问题便成为了重中之重。

#### TPWallet打包的基本步骤

准备一个完整的开发环境是十分关键的。确保你的操作系统、编程语言、必要的开发工具都已经安装并配置妥当。

当代码编写完成后,打包的命令通常取决于你所使用的开发工具和框架。对于大多数开发者来说,需要选择合适的工具进行打包。

#### 常见的打包问题

打包过程中常见的问题包括编译错误、依赖库缺失以及运行时错误。了解这些问题的详细情况,可以帮助你更快更有效地找到解决方案。

#### 逐步解决打包问题的策略

当面对打包错误时,首先可以尝试清理并重新编译项目,修复项目中的潜在错误。同时需要仔细检查每一个依赖关系,确保都已正确配置。

更新工具和库也可能有助于解决一些已经修复的已知问题。

#### 如何TPWallet的打包过程

考虑使用Docker容器可以大大提升打包的效率和一致性。通过创建镜像,你可以快速构建、测试并部署你的TPWallet应用。

此外,通过代码结构及资源管理,也能显著缩短打包时间。

#### 目标平台的适配

对于不同的平台,如安卓或iOS,开发者需要特别注意适配问题。例如,安卓平台可能会在权限管理上有不同的要求,而iOS则要求更严格的代码签名和审查流程。

#### 常见问题解答(FAQ)

在此部分,你可以找出一些常见的打包问题,深入解析,帮助开发者解决困惑。

--- ### 相关问题详解 ####

如何排查未知问题?

排查未知问题时,首先应该保证错误信息的详细记录。使用日志系统可以有效捕获运行时出现的异常和错误信息。同时开发者可以查阅官方文档或社区论坛,寻找相似问题的解决方案。

结构化的调试过程也十分重要,可以逐步分解应用的运行过程,逐一确认各个模块的正确性。在发现问题后,也应及时与团队中的其他成员沟通讨论,协作解决问题。

####

打包错误如何定位?

为了更好地帮助您,我将为“tpwallet打包中怎么办”这个话题提供一个易于大众且的,同时附上相关的关键词和内容大纲。

TPWallet打包中出现问题的解决方案指南

打包错误定位的关键在于仔细分析编译器反馈的错误信息。通常编译器会指出错误的具体行数和类型,帮助开发者快速找到问题的“根源”。此外,使用工具如IDE自带的调试工具,可以更直观地见到问题所在。

建议排查过程中,创建一个详细的文档,记录每一次调整和发现的问题,随着时间的推移,这将成为重要的知识积累。

####

有哪些工具可以辅助打包?

市面上有许多工具可以帮助简化和增强打包过程。常用的工具如Gradle、Maven(对于Java项目)、npm(对于JavaScript项目)等,帮助你管理依赖和构建项目。

此外,构建工具如Webpack和Babel也在前端开发中起到重要作用,能够解决现代JavaScript和资源打包的场景。

####

怎样处理第三方库的兼容性问题?

为了更好地帮助您,我将为“tpwallet打包中怎么办”这个话题提供一个易于大众且的,同时附上相关的关键词和内容大纲。

TPWallet打包中出现问题的解决方案指南

处理第三方库的兼容性问题时,首先应查看各个库的官方文档,确认它们之间的版本要求。如果可能,尽量使用稳定版本的库,避免使用太过更新的测试版本。

在开发过程中,如果出现库之间的冲突,可以考虑使用版本管理工具管理这些依赖。举例来说,npm的package.json文件就能帮助你维护项目所需的库版本。

####

如果使用了旧版TPWallet,可能遇到什么问题?

使用旧版TPWallet会让你面临诸多安全和稳定性隐患。旧版本往往缺乏最新的安全补丁和功能,可能无法支持新特性和新协议。

建议开发者及时更新到最新版本,以获取更好的性能和更高的安全性。定期检查更新,同时查看发行说明,了解新版本的改进和变化。

####

如何提升打包的稳定性?

提升打包稳定性的有效方法之一是创建一个自动化的CI/CD(持续集成/持续部署)流程。通过自动化构建、测试和部署,可以减少人为操作带来的错误。

此外,使用容器化技术如Docker,可以确保不同环境中的一致性,避免因环境差异造成的打包不稳定问题。

####

社区和论坛的资源利用

开发者在遇到问题时,积极利用社区和论坛的资源,可以极大提升解决问题的效率。在GitHub、Stack Overflow等平台上,可以找到许多相似问题的讨论及解决方案。

此外,参加开发者大会、线上讲座等活动,也能够拓宽视野,抓住最新的技术动态与社区趋势,建议多与同行交流,分享经验。

以上是针对“TPWallet打包中怎么办”这个话题的内容大纲及相关问题,您可以根据具体需求进一步扩展内容。希望这些信息能够帮助您顺利解决打包问题!